Early Slate

Tampa Bay Rays vs LHP Wade LeBlanc – 5.5 implied runs

It is official, LHP Wade LeBlanc has fully assimilated into a Mariners pitcher with four home runs in his last outing, eight over his last four and 25 on the season.  With Seattle essentially running a four southpaw rotation with a bullpen day in the vacated RHP Mike Leake slot it is easy for teams to become accustomed to seeing lefties.  This will be the third day in a row for the Devil Rays and with LeBlanc getting hammered from both sides of the plate LHB: 272 TBF, .235 ISO, 15 HR and RHB: 848 TBF .189 ISO, 34 HR since the beginning of last season look to anyone with power that makes the lineup in the day game after a night game such as Travis d’Arnaud, Austin Meadows, Tommy Pham, Mike Zunino and even Nerd Power himself aka Eric Sogard for some differentiation.

Main Slate

New York Mets vs RHP Adam Plutko – 5.3 implied runs

It has been a while since I have mentioned the Metropolitans in this column and truthfully I am surprised to do it in the absence of Robinson Cano and Jeff McNeil, yet here we are… RHP Adam Plutko has allowed four home runs in his last two starts and 19 on the season in just 71.1 innings with a 2.68 HR/9 to same-handed hitters and a 2.10 HR/9 to lefties.  The Mets we want to target are a very specific trio with Pete Alonso, Michael Conforto and J.D. Davis with Davis being optional, or if we want a full stack then adding in either Wilson Ramos or Amed Rosario would be the way to go.

Evening Slate

Houston Astros vs LHP Daniel Norris – 5.9 Implied Runs

This just isn’t fair… on the season the Astros have a 143 wRC+ against lefties. Weighted runs created plus is an advanced metric that neutralizes ballpark factors creating a league wide scoring efficiency baseline of 100.  This means that they are scoring 43% MORE runs than the average team.

Houston has the second highest walk rate, the second lowest strikeout rate and lead the league with a .241 ISO. Plus LHP Daniel Norris has allowed a .222 ISO to fellow lefties and a .200 ISO to opposite-handed hitters since the beginning of last season.

Considering price, position eligibility, potential production and projected popularity, my order of preference is Yordan Alvarez, Alex Bregman, George Springer, Jose Altuve, Yuli Gurriel, Robinson Chirinos, Carlos Correa, Josh Reddick, Jake Marisnick and Michael Brantley.

Late Slate

Oakland Athletics vs LHP J.A. Happ – 5.2 implied runs

Props to LHP J.A. Happ for not allowing a home run to Baltimore in his last start, of course he has allowed 29 on the season which is the fifth most and his 56 since the beginning last year is the sixth most in the time frame. Over his last 402 lefty/righty matchups, Happ has allowed a .359 wOBA with a .236 ISO and we know that the Athletics will do their best to load their lineup with right-handed batsmen.  Mark Canha, Matt Chapman and the slumping Khris Davis will be the first trio to target, but for differentiation we can use the recently returned Stephen Piscotty (sore ankle), lefty Matt Olson (.310 ISO this season in 108 lefty/lefty matchups) and Marcus Semien who has found his power stroke (well for him anyway) once again.
